Current Food Trends
Recent studies indicate a shift in consumer behavior towards plant-based diets, organic products, and locally-sourced ingredients. According to a report by the Plant Based Foods Association, the plant-based food sector grew significantly in 2022, with an increase in retail sales by over twenty percent, highlighting a growing demand for healthier food options.
Additionally, the COVID-19 pandemic has redefined our relationship with food, with many individuals prioritising health and wellness. Grocery stores have reported a surge in sales of fresh produce, whole grains, and health supplements, signalling a broader shift towards nutritious eating habits.
The Economic Impact of Food Choices
The food industry plays a vital role in the economy. In 2023, food expenditures in the United Kingdom are expected to exceed £200 billion, with increasing consumer demand for food transparency and sustainability. This has pressured companies to innovate in food production, aiming to provide healthier options while addressing environmental concerns.
